During Black Friday*, GMV and orders YoY growth reached 41% and 29% respectively

NEW YORK--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- VTEX (NYSE: VTEX), the global enterprise digital commerce platform for premier brands and retailers, announced today a global strong performance during the start of the holiday shopping season, with the kickoff of Black Friday*. GMV reached US$353.8 million, representing an increase of 41% in USD over the same period in 2022 and 31% on an FX-neutral basis, and a 29% increase in orders year-over-year.

This Black Friday*, VTEX witnessed a significant GMV increase in verticals such as Apparel & Accessories (+43% YoY), Beauty and Health (+41% YoY) and Electronics (+39% YoY), in the more than 38 countries where it currently operates.

VTEX Black Friday* 2023 Highlights:

  • Black Friday* sales reached the highest peak on November 24th, at 8:47 am ET, when VTEX customers registered 2.8 thousand orders per minute.
  • VTEX enabled 2.8 million consumer orders globally from their preferred brands and retailers during Black Friday* 2023, representing a year-over-year increase of 29%.
  • The top five regions with the highest year-over-year growth in volume were Brazil, Europe, the United States, South Africa, and Colombia.

* The Black Friday disclosed data is based on gross merchandise volume (GMV) and orders by VTEX customers around the world from 23/Nov/2023 00:00 UTC (Thursday) to 24/Nov/2023 23:59 UTC (Friday), and compared to 24/Nov/2022 00:00 UTC (Thursday) to 25/Nov/2022 23:59 UTC (Friday).
